How much power does a solar panel produce?

A solar panel produces between 1.1 and 2.5 kilowatt-hours of power in one day, which amounts to 33 to 75 kWh per month. As an average home in the US uses about 900 kWh, you will need between 27 and 12 solar panels to cover that usage, depending on the panel efficiency and how many watts each solar panel produce.

How much energy does a 400 watt solar panel produce?

A 400-watt panel can generate roughly 1.6–2.5 kWh of energy per day, depending on local sunlight. To cover the average U.S. household’s 900 kWh/month consumption, you typically need 12–18 panels. Output depends on sun hours, roof direction, panel technology, shading, temperature and age.

How many volts does a 250W solar panel produce?

A 12v 250W solar panel will produce 18 volts under direct sunlight, and 13 amps This is why we use a charge controller or regulator which regulates the voltage of the solar panel to charge the battery (12, 24, or 48V) Must Read: What size charge controller for 250W solar panel?
